Member of Parliament for Bortianor Ngleshie Amanfro constituency, Sylvester Tetteh has made a U-turn on his allegations about former Ghana captain, Asamoah Gyan eyeing his seat.
Sylvester Tetteh earlier accused some elders in the New Patriotic Party for urging Asamoah Gyan to come and contest him in the constituency.
However, in a new twist of events, Sylvester Tetteh has set the records straight saying that Asamoah Gyan has never been interested in his position.
“Let me say that Asamoah Gyan hasn’t said he is coming to contest. He has denied it. He is my good friend. We chat almost any other day,” the MP confirmed.
“He is my good friend. It is some people (who are instigating that narrative),” he stressed before confirming further that Gyan was not a registered member of the NPP.
